until today i dun understand why 2 albino parents can have non-albino offsprings...

anyway, few days back the pair spawned again, but the eggs all came out of the cave - i suspect too many 'intruders' going into the cave and the daddy cannot take it so probably accidentally fanned the new eggs out - i took the whole bunch of yellow grapes out for 'artificial' hatching:
